Located about 15 minutes from the airport & offers a transfer for R10 but you can do it for R3 by taxi eg Otaxi/ Tasleem which require you to use their Apps. (Yango requires an Omani phone number). Whatsapp requires a VPN eg Turbo for calls but not for texts. It is clean and generally well maintained and the room had a safe, aircon, hairdryer, tv, tea/coffee facilities with 2 (500ml) bottles of water replenished daily, shower and shampoo/body wash. There are many tv channels, mainly Arabic, a few in English and 1 in French. The room was quite spacious but half the rooms face the sides of the hotel which have no view and little natural light. My room was one with a cupboard for an air con pump which was noisy and there was even more noise from the aircon in the neighbouring buildings. The only restaurant is Thai/Chinese with a reasonable buffet breakfast and a small a la carte lunch/dinner selection of mainly spicy dishes. The 1/2 board menu is more limited for R5/day (£10) even though the website says R7.5. However a large deposit is required if you are not paying daily. There is a gym and a pool but although the website says it is outdoors it is on the 5th Floor with an opening above it. To sunbathe it is necessary to use the rooftop area however there are no sunbeds, just chairs and it can be quite windy at times. There is a Pizza Hut, Sushi Station, well stocked minimarket and Pharmacy in the same block. The Staff are friendly and helpful but can lack local knowledge.
